With the change in weather, its effect on the skin starts showing. People who have oily skin have to face stickiness in the summer season. Due to this, oil starts accumulating near the nose, chin and cheek bone area, due to which one has to face the problem of blackheads. Most people use many things to remove these blackheads. But not cleaning the skin regularly increases this type of problem. Know those natural tips with the help of which you can get rid of the problem of blackheads (Home remedies for blackheads).

Regarding this, skin experts say that the skin produces natural oil, which starts accumulating in open pores. Blackheads start forming from dust particles that accumulate with the oil. These blackheads turn into pimples . Mostly the problem of blackheads is faced on the nose, lips and chin. To get relief from this, it is necessary to take care of some things.

Keep these things in mind to avoid blackheads (How to remove blackheads at home)

1. Cleansing is important

Dead skin cells start accumulating due to clogged pores . Which increases the problem of blackheads. To get relief from this, clean the skin with a mild cleanser 2 to 3 times a day and then tone the skin.

2. Keep the skin moisturized

After washing your face, apply a gel-based moisturizer on your skin as per your oily skin type to avoid the effects of free radicals. This helps maintain the elasticity of the skin and prevents the problem of blemishes on the skin. It also helps in removing blackheads.

3. Don't sleep with makeup on

Do not forget to clean your face after coming from a late night party. Actually, keeping makeup on the face for a long time affects the texture of the skin. Also, one has to face blackheads and excess oil. For this, choose makeup products according to oily skin and remove them.

4. Use an exfoliating scrub

To avoid the problem of free radicals, use exfoliating scrub. This can help in avoiding excess oil, acne and blackheads on the skin . Actually, exfoliating scrub helps in removing dead skin cells. This keeps the skin clean and healthy.

Know the home remedies to remove blackheads (Home remedies to remove blackheads)

1. Oatmeal powder and milk

Prepare a thick paste by mixing milk as required in 1 teaspoon oatmeal powder.

Now apply this paste around the nose, forehead and near the lips and scrub for some time. Wash the face after leaving it for 10 minutes.

2. Licorice and honey

Melithi powder is not only beneficial for the throat, but it also provides relief from oxidative stress on the skin. It also helps in removing the problem of open pores. For this, mix 1 teaspoon honey in 1 teaspoon liquorice and apply it on blackheads and massage with light hands. Blackheads can be removed with this.

3. Gram flour, flour and turmeric

For this, make a paste by mixing half a teaspoon of gram flour with equal amount of flour and a pinch of turmeric. Now apply this paste on blackheads and leave it. This helps in removing the problem of dirt and dead skin cells accumulated on the skin. Also, it helps in getting rid of tanning.

4. Brown sugar, lemon and honey

Lemon, which is rich in vitamin C, increases the amount of collagen in the skin. It also helps in solving the problem of excess oil accumulated on the skin. Mix 1 teaspoon of lemon juice and half a teaspoon of honey in 1 teaspoon of brown sugar and apply it on the blackheads and rub it for some time. This makes the skin soft and blackheads can be removed easily. Using it twice a week gives relief from blackheads on the face and forehead.
